Generative Shape Design

Generative Shape Design allows you to quickly model both


simple and complex shapes using wireframe and surface
features. It provides a large set of tools for creating and editing
shape designs and, when combined with other products such as
Part Design, it meets the requirements of solid-based hybrid
modeling.

The feature-based approach offers a productive and intuitive


design environment to capture and re-use design methodologies
and specifications. This new application is intended for both the
expert and the casual user. Its intuitive interface offers the
possibility to produce precision shape designs with very few
interactions. The dialog boxes are self explanatory and require
practically no methodology, all defining steps being
commutative.

Digitized Shape Editor

Digitized Shape Editor enables you to read, import and process parts
digitized to clouds of points. These clouds of points can then be used
in Quick Surface Reconstruction, DMU or Surface Machining or
exported to various other formats.

Digitized Shape Editor

proposes several import formats,

takes special characteristics of imported shapes into account


(free edges, facets, ...), if requested,

ensures a fast processing of clouds (that may contain several


millions of points) through filtering, activation and removal
functions,

makes the manipulations of the various elements constituting


cloud of points (points, scans, grids, meshes) easy,

provides edition functions such as merging and aligning of

Quick Surface Reconstruction

Quick Surface Reconstruction easily and quickly recovers surfaces


from digitized data that has been cleaned up and tessellated using
the Digitized Shape Editor product. 

Quick Surface Reconstruction offers several approaches to recover


surfaces depending of the type of shape: 

Organic shapes, i.e. free form surfaces, without features such


as cylinders, fillets, planes, etc.

Mechanical shapes (plane, cylinder, sphere, cone).

Polygonal Modeling

In 3D computer graphics, polygonal modeling is an approach for


modeling objects by representing or approximating their surfaces
using polygons. Polygonal modeling is well suited to scanline
rendering and is therefore the method of choice for real-time
computer graphics. Alternate methods of representing 3D objects
include NURBS surfaces, subdivision surfaces, and equation-based
representations used in ray tracers. See polygon mesh for a
description of how polygonal models are represented and stored

Tessellation

A tessellation or tiling of the plane is a collection of plane figures


that fills the plane with no overlaps and no gaps. One may also
speak of tessellations of the parts of the plane or of other surfaces.

Automotive Body in White Fastening

Automotive Body in White Fastening is a product dedicated to the


design of Automotive Body In White fasteners. It supports welding
technologies and mechanical clinching, along with adhesives, sealers,
and mastics.

For each of these general fastening technologies, specific


fastening process codes along with their matching relevant
parameters can be set-up in standard file. This file can be fully
customized by the customer, according to company or industry
specific standards requirements. Its feature-based approach
offers both a highly structured and intuitive design environment.

Fasteners can be gathered so as to connect specific contact


zones of the parts to join. You can create, edit and delete spot-
like fasteners.

In addition to placing the fasteners, flat reports can be issued


from the application in order to list the data that can be imported
to a neutral ASCII text format, providing opening with customer
legacy systems.

Concurrent Engineering

Concurrent Engineering is a work methodology based on the


parallelization of tasks (ie. concurrently). It refers to an approach
used in product development in which functions of design
engineering, manufacturing engineering and other functions are
integrated to reduce the elapsed time required to bring a new
product to the market.

Core and Cavity Design

Core and Cavity Design is intended for:

a quick analysis of a molded part (cost feasibility),

the preparation of the molded part for mold design and mold
manufacturing.

Core and Cavity Design defines the core and cavity sides of a part,
including any sliders or lifters that may be required, so as to produce
a Molded Part ready to be used with Mold Tooling Design. It includes
functions that define:

the pulling directions,

the parting line

the parting surface,

the splitting surface,

Functional Modelling Part

CATIA Functional Modeling Part offers a new approach to developing


3D digital models, called "functional modeling." The objective of
functional modeling is to enable product designers to focus on the
functional goals and design constraints of their product. Capturing
this information in the product model provides the information from
which geometric form can be derived through the combination of
behavioral features and a minimum of geometric construction. The
end result is a significant reduction in the effort required to generate
the 3D model by allowing more time for designers to focus on
engineering issues, exploring alternative design approaches, and
optimizing their design.

CATIA Functional Modeling Part provides tools to create volumes


and features that contain inherent behaviors and which interact. The
behaviors capture different design functions, such as adding
material, subtracting material, or protecting space. Because they
contain inherent behaviors and they interact, they are called
"functional volumes" and "functional features.“
